Adoption Assistance in Asheville, NC

Simplify the adoption process with experienced legal guidance.

Adoption involves careful legal steps, and families deserve guidance that keeps the process as clear and manageable as possible. Montgomery Legal PLLC helps clients in Asheville and Western North Carolina understand the requirements and move forward with personalized legal support so you can focus on your growing family.

Who this is for

Families come to this work at different points: a stepparent who has already been raising a child, relatives who need the legal relationship to match the home the child already lives in, or parents who are beginning a private adoption and need the court filings done correctly. The common thread is that adoption is a legal process, not only a family decision. Missing a consent, a notice, or a hearing date can delay a result everyone already treats as settled.

This office assists with the family-law side of adoption. We do not handle immigration or visa work as part of this practice area.

How we can help

  • Explaining the legal steps that apply to your situation so you know what has to happen before a decree, not only what you hope will happen.
  • Preparing and filing the petition and supporting papers the court requires.
  • Identifying whose consent or notice is needed, and helping complete those steps when they are part of the case.
  • Coordinating required reports, home studies, or other court-ordered items when they apply.
  • Representing you at hearings so the file is complete and the request is presented clearly.
  • Following through after the hearing on the paperwork that makes the adoption effective in school, medical, and other records.

What to expect

The first conversation is about the child’s current legal status, who already has parental rights, and what you are asking the court to do. From there we map the filings, the people who must be notified, and a realistic sequence. Timelines depend on the facts and on the court. We will not invent a date we cannot control.
